Overview

A leading online casino and sports betting operator is seeking a Senior Financial Analyst to join their Financial Planning & Analysis (FP&A) team. This role supports budgeting, forecasting, cross-functional planning, commercial opportunity modeling, reporting, competitive intelligence, and ad hoc analysis. The position offers the opportunity to impact a rapidly growing company in the online gaming industry.

Responsibilities

  • Provide FP&A support including budgeting, reporting, and financial analysis.
  • Evaluate domestic and international growth opportunities by incorporating market dynamics, regulatory factors, customer behavior, and financial assumptions into business models.
  • Utilize AI tools to enhance financial modeling, forecasting accuracy, and support business decisions.
  • Lead weekly and monthly reporting of revenue and operational KPIs, delivering insights and identifying trends for management.
  • Review, benchmark, and analyze performance against competitors to inform management recommendations.
  • Develop financial models to assess a wide range of commercial opportunities in the U.S. and internationally.
  • Collaborate with business units to identify key drivers and trends to support company objectives.
  • Improve FP&A processes by enhancing financial models, automation, and reporting tools.
  • Analyze the financial impact of major sporting events, seasonal trends, and customer behavior to improve forecasting and provide actionable insights.
  • Manage ad hoc requests independently.
  • Perform additional duties as assigned.
